It's a brain child of a friend I met many moons ago at Interlochen Arts Academy, and I was very pleasantly surprised to hear from him this year when I moved to Boston.  He told me his vision about this new orchestra, and I knew that as soon as I heard him through, it would be exactly what the Boston classical music scene needed!

At Phoenix, we don't think that classical music is a dying art form.  We think that the music is great, and that many people love it, and would love it, if the concerts were 'packaged' differently.  We want to dispel the aura of intimidation from live classical symphony concerts. We want everyone who comes to our concerts to leave the venue having had the greatest time and wanting to come back to listen to more amazing music!
